Starbucks Peach Cobbler Frappuccino with Coffee Ingredients
Course Drinks
Prep Time 10 minutesminutes
Servings 4
Ingredients
2CupsUnsweetened Almond Milk
2CupsIce Cubes
1CupVanilla Protein Powder (Linked in Description)
1TspVanilla Extract
2TblSugar Free Vanilla Syrup (Linked in Description)
1CupCold Brewed Coffee
1CupPeach Slices, Fresh or Frozen (IF using fresh, peel them)
1TblSugar Free Hazelnut Syrup (Linked in Description)
2TblSugar Free Peach Syrup (Linked in Description)
1TspGround Cinnamon
Fat Free or Sugar Free Whipped Cream, Optional
Cinnamon for Topping, Optional
Sugar Free Caramel or Peach Syrup (For Swirls), Optional and (Linked in Description)
Instructions
Make the Vanilla Frappuccino Base
In a blender, combine unsweetened almond milk, ice cubes, vanilla protein powder, vanilla extract, and sugar-free vanilla syrup. Blend until smooth and creamy.
Add Coffee and Peach Cobbler Ingredients
Add cold brew coffee, peach slices, sugar-free hazelnut syrup, sugar-free peach syrup, and ground cinnamon to the blender. Blend again until smooth and well combined.
Create Swirls in Glasses
Tilt each glass slightly and drizzle sugar-free caramel syrup or sugar-free peach syrup along the inside, starting from the top and allowing it to drip down in swirls. Slowly rotate the glass as you drizzle to create an even pattern of swirls.
Pour and Serve
Carefully pour the frappuccino mixture into the glasses, taking care not to disturb the syrup swirls too much. Top each glass with a small amount of light whipped cream. Sprinkle with a little more cinnamon. Serve immediately and enjoy your refreshing, low-calorie Peach Cobbler Frappuccino with coffee!
This makes 4 servings at about 12 ounces per serving. On WW, each serving is 2 WW Points. Enjoy!
